Besom / Witch's Broom - Folklore / Symbolism Since Ancient Times, the Witch's Broom or Besom has been symbolic of
Fertility & Cleansing. They are used to sweep the circle (or any area)
free of unwanted energies, so that the desired energy can fill the space.
The long-standing tradition of "jumping the broom" at weddings
and handfastings was done to ensure the couple's fertility.
The Pentacle - Symbolism The Pentacle or Pentagram is a 5 pointed star that
is often, but not always, encircled with the circle of Unity. It represents
the domination of Spirit or Divine Will over base matter, and the elements
of Spirit, Earth, Water, Fire, and Air. The pentacle has been a symbol of
protection and spiritual growth for millennia. At its points are the stages
of Life: birth, initiation, consummation, repose, and death, with the circle
bringing us back to birth in the cycle of reincarnation.
